Did you know that there are over 20 Hindu temples in South Africa alone? That's right, the Hindu community in Africa is thriving.

 One of the most famous African Hindu temples is the Sri Siva Soobramoniar Temple in Durban, South Africa. It's been around since 1885!

 Many African Hindu temples are built in the traditional Dravidian style, which originated in the southern part of India.

 The temples are often adorned with intricate carvings and colorful paintings, making them a feast for the eyes.

 African Hindu temples are not just places of worship - they also serve as community centers, offering classes and events for people of all ages.

In many African Hindu temples, you'll find statues of deities like Ganesha, Shiva, and Vishnu.

 The temples are often surrounded by beautiful gardens and fountains, creating a peaceful and serene atmosphere.

Many African Hindu temples hold elaborate festivals throughout the year, complete with music, dance, and delicious food.
